Process and plant for the production of a product gas containing nitrogen and hydrogen from ammonia, the process comprising the steps of: i) pre-cracking an ammonia feed stream to a pre-cracked process gas containing hydrogen, nitrogen, ammonia by contact with a first ammonia cracking catalyst; ii-1) non-catalytic partial oxidation of the pre-cracked process gas with an oxygen containing gas to a process gas containing nitrogen, water, nitrogen oxides and residual amounts of ammonia; ii-2) cracking of at least a part of the residual amounts of ammonia to hydrogen and nitrogen in the process gas by contact with a second ammonia cracking catalyst and simultaneously reducing the amounts of nitrogen oxides to nitrogen and water by reaction with at least a portion of the hydrogen formed during at least the pre-cracking of the ammonia feed stream, thereby producing said product gas containing nitrogen and hydrogen; iii) withdrawing the product gas. The product gas is purified downstream to a hydrogen product.

S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R BALANCING AN ELECTRICAL POWER SYSTEM USING METHANOL
A power balancing system and process is provided, in which a first electrolysis unit (10) outputs a first hydrogen rich stream (11), which is converted in a methanol synthesis plant (20) to a first methanol-rich stream (21). A methanol storage unit (40) receives and stores the first methanol-rich stream (21). When additional electrical power is required, methanol from the methanol storage unit (40) can be used for power generation. The system and process allow excess electrical power to be converted into and stored as methanol during periods of low demand, and used to generate electrical power when demand is higher.

METHOD FOR REDUCING CO2 EMISSION IN A METHANOL PLANT USING COMBINED FUEL FIRED REFORMING AND ELECTRICAL REFORMING
A process and system are provided for the preparation of syngas and methanol with reduced carbon dioxide emissions. The method comprises dividing a hydrocarbon and steam feed into two streams, one subjected to fuel fired reforming and the other to electrical reforming. At least a portion of the synthesis gas from the electrical reforming is processed in a shift section and a carbon dioxide removal section, producing a hydrogen rich gas and a carbon dioxide rich gas. The hydrogen rich gas is used as fuel in the fuel fired reforming process, reducing the need for hydrocarbon fuel. The system allows for flexible adjustment of process streams and integration with methanol synthesis, enabling significant reductions in natural gas and oxygen consumption and overall carbon dioxide emissions.

HYDROPROCESSING OF RENEWABLE FEEDS FOR PRODUCING HYDROCARBON PRODUCTS
The invention relates to a process and plant for producing a hydrocarbon product from a renewable hydrocarbonaceous feedstock. The process includes hydroprocessing the renewable hydrocarbonaceous feedstock, which involves conducting the feed stream to a catalytic hydrodeoxygenation (HDO) unit to produce a hydrodeoxygenated effluent stream. This stream is then conducted to a hot separator and a cold separator, with portions of the overhead stream recycled back to the catalytic HDO unit. The bottom stream from the hot separator is conducted to a stripper, with the overhead stream combined with the bottom stream from said cold separator. Impurities are removed from the combined stream, and the resulting sour gas stream is conducted to a separator. The bottom stream from the stripper is conducted to a catalytic hydroisomerization (ISOM) unit to produce an isomerized effluent stream, which is then conducted to a cold separator. The hydrocarbon product, such as jet fuel for use as sustainable aviation fuel and/or hydrotreated vegetable oil (HVO), is then separated from the bottom stream of the cold separator.
